Understanding Logistics Risk

Logistics risk encompasses a wide range of potential issues that can impact the smooth operation of supply chains. These risks can be categorized into several types, including operational, financial, and strategic risks. Operational risks might include delays in transportation, supply chain disruptions, and quality issues. Financial risks could arise from fluctuations in currency exchange rates, fuel prices, and insurance premiums. Strategic risks involve long-term issues such as changes in market demand, regulatory changes, and technological advancements. By understanding these risks, participants can develop strategies to mitigate their impact and ensure business continuity.
